Jobless Claims Slightly Lower from Previous Week
Published at | Updated at(WASHINGTON) — Jobless claims were lower last week, decreasing by 3,000, according to the latest figures released Thursday by the Labor Department.
For the week ending Dec. 6, the number of people filing for unemployment benefits fell to 294,000. The previous week claims stood at 297,000.
The Labor Department said there were no “special factors” impacting that week’s figures.
The four-week moving average rose to 299,250 from last week’s revised average of 299,000.
